Factors Influencing Apartment Pricing

When searching for affordable 2-bedroom apartments, it’s essential to consider the factors that impact pricing. These factors can significantly affect the rent cost, so it’s crucial to understand their influence.
Location
The location of an apartment plays a significant role in determining its price. Proximity to urban centers, public transportation, schools, shopping centers, and other amenities greatly impacts rent costs. The demand for apartments in these areas drives up prices. For example, apartments near city centers or public transportation hubs tend to be more expensive due to their convenience and accessibility. On the other hand, apartments located in outer suburbs or rural areas may be more affordable but may also lack accessibility to these amenities.
Size
The size of an apartment is another factor that affects its price. Larger apartments with more rooms, square footage, and storage space generally come at a higher cost. However, smaller apartments can be more affordable, especially for singles or couples. It’s essential to consider your needs and lifestyle when weighing the pros and cons of apartment size.
Age of the Building
The age of the building is another factor that impacts apartment pricing. Newer buildings often come with modern amenities and higher rent costs. Older buildings, while potentially more affordable, may require more maintenance and repairs. Additionally, the age of the building can impact its energy efficiency and overall living conditions.
Proximity to Public Transportation
Proximity to public transportation is a critical factor in determining apartment pricing. Apartments near public transportation hubs tend to be more expensive due to their convenience and accessibility. This can significantly impact your daily commute and overall quality of life. According to a study by the American Public Transportation Association, residents who live near public transportation hubs tend to have a higher income and better access to job opportunities.
Proximity to Schools
Proximity to schools is another factor that affects apartment pricing. Apartments in areas with good school districts tend to be more expensive due to their desirability. This can be a significant factor for families with children. According to a study by Zillow, homes near highly-rated schools tend to appreciate in value faster and have higher resale values.

Organizing Your Move with a Budget of $1000 or Less
Planning a move can be overwhelming, especially when you’re working with a tight budget. However, with some careful planning and research, you can execute a successful move without breaking the bank. Here are some steps to help you organize your move with a budget of $1000 or less.
Step 1: Create a Moving Budget
Before you start planning, it’s essential to set a realistic budget for your move. Make a list of all the expenses you anticipate, including packing supplies, transportation, and labor costs. Be sure to include any additional expenses, such as storage fees or utility deposits. Having a clear understanding of your costs will help you stay on track and make financial decisions throughout the process.
Step 2: Gather Free or Low-Cost Moving Supplies
Instead of buying expensive packing materials, consider gathering free or low-cost options. You can:
- Ask friends or family members if they have any spare boxes or packing materials
- Visit local grocery stores or liquor stores to collect boxes and other materials
- Borrow packing materials from work or school
- Buy packing materials in bulk from discount stores or second-hand markets
Save money on packing supplies and focus on more essential expenses.
Step 3: Consider DIY Packing
Packing can be a significant expense, but you can save money by doing it yourself. Create a packing schedule and set aside time each day to pack non-essential items. Be sure to:
- Use a labeling system to keep track of your boxes and ensure they’re easy to identify
- Prioritize the most important items and pack them first
- Use a “first night” box to pack essentials like toilet paper, towels, and a change of clothes
DIY packing may require more time and effort, but it can save you a substantial amount of money in the long run.
Step 4: Research Affordable Moving Options
When it comes to transportation, you have several affordable options to choose from:
- Rent a moving truck or van and handle the move yourself
- Use a freight service or carrier to transport your belongings
- Ask friends or family members to help with the move in exchange for pizza or other compensation
- Consider a portable storage container service for an easy and stress-free move
Compare prices and services to find the best option for your budget.
Step 5: Prioritize and Downsize
Before the move, take the opportunity to declutter and downsize. This will not only save you money on moving costs but also reduce stress and make your new space more comfortable. Consider:
- Donating or selling items you no longer need or use
- Sorting through sentimental items and keeping only the essential or meaningful ones
- Distributing items to friends or family members who might appreciate them
Simplifying your belongings will make your move much easier and more enjoyable.
Step 6: Create a Moving Day Schedule
Plan your move ahead of time to ensure a smooth and stress-free experience. Make a detailed schedule, including:
- The moving truck or driver’s arrival and departure times
- The packing and loading process
- Catering or refreshments for the movers
Stay organized and focused to make the moving day a success.
